What a great hunt! Me and the youngest was going to hunt down the road from the house until 10pm last night when the oldest decided she was going to sleep in and go in the evening so we went behind the house to a food plot instead. Major feed was 5-7am this morning and sunrise was at 7:53 and we got in the stand at 7:15. Man was it foggy! I didn't expect much with the warm temps but boy was I wrong. We were sitting on a 3/4 ac food plot with the back half in peas that the deer never touched. They are waist high now. At 7:39 we both see movement and say "deer!" From the glow up top I new it was a buck and not just ears. Jaden soon after said the same thing. I looked at the deer through the scope and saw a rack. I told her it was a good deer, do your best to stay calm and we needed to get him on the ground..
The deer was coming through the peas at 80 yds out and walking right at us not stopping at all. At 35 yds he turned to his right- our left and sped up some. She already had the gun up and watching and I told her to get ready I was going to stop him and she needed to shoot when he did. I bleated, he paused for for a split second and kept going. He only had 25 yds to go and he was gone. I bleated again louder, he stoped and looked and BOOM she shot. He mule kicked and took off with his back end lowering to the ground as he went.
Jaden told me that she prayed that she could kill a buck this morning no matter what size. Her prayers were answered in a big way. Thank you Lord!! We talked it over, she assured me that she had it on him good, we gave thanks, gave hugs high 5's and sat for 45 more minutes, it about killed her to do that....
We got out of the stand and 40 yds later here is what we found. Her 5th deer and best buck to date. Perfect double lung shot.
